GNU Project's publication of CIDE, the Collaborative International Dictionary of English
Stipple \Stip"ple\, v. t. [imp. & p. p.
Stippled
; p. pr. & vb.
n.
Stippling
.] [D. stippelen to make points, to spot, dot,
from stippel, dim. of stip a dot, spot.]
1. To engrave by means of dots, in distinction from engraving
in lines.
[1913 Webster]
The interlaying of small pieces can not altogether
avoid a broken, stippled, spotty effect. --Milman.
[1913 Webster]
2. To paint, as in water colors, by small, short touches
which together produce an even or softly graded surface.
[1913 Webster] Stipple
WordNet
stippled
adj : having a pattern of dots [syn:
dotted
,
flecked
,
specked
,
speckled
]
